The Star Man

While others may have returned more impressive statistics, Patrick Mahomes is the NFL player with the highest profile right now. In the post Tom Brady era, the Chiefs have been the most successful franchise in the competition, and quarterback Mahomes continues to pull the strings.

As they headed into the playoffs, Super Bowl odds listed Kansas City as second favorites to lift the Vince Lombardi Trophy, just behind the Philadelphia Eagles. If they are to make it three wins in succession, Patrick Mahomes will be pivotal to their success.

While he’s not been at his absolute best this season, the Chiefs’ starting QB has returned some respectable stats. After 16 games of the campaign, Mahomes ranks seventh out of all quarterbacks with 26 touchdown passes and 3,928 passing yards. He’ll want to improve on those numbers, and it will be fascinating to see how his postseason develops.

MVP Contenders

As the playoffs began. Jared Goff was one of three contenders for the NFL season MVP. Patrick Mahomes, meanwhile, was down in sixth place and seemingly out of contention.

The other three names in the frame were Lamar Jackson of the Baltimore Ravens, Buffalo Bills quarterback Josh Allen and Philadelphia Eagles running back Saquon Barkley. Barkley is an interesting inclusion as the only non-quarterback in the top four, and he fully justifies his nomination.

It’s been a solid season for the Eagles man who had returned over 2,000 rushing yards as his team headed into the playoffs. Barkley had also provided an exceptional thirteen touchdowns as Philadelphia emerged as the team most likely to challenge the Super Bowl favorites.

Lamar Jackson and Josh Allen will also feature in the postseason, and both men will have more chances to secure that MVP award. Baltimore’s Jackson is another man to have produced more than 4,000 passing yards in the regular season, and he’s also delivered a stunning 41 touchdowns.

Josh Allen’s passing yards may be down in comparison to other quarterbacks. In fact, he ranks down in 14th place for this particular statistic, but the Buffalo Bills’ key man has been consistent in other areas. With strong support, he’s only been sacked 14 times this season, and with just six interceptions, he’s one of the best in the business for keeping the offensive play going.

Best of the Rest

Among those with an outside chance of landing the MVP award this season is the Philadelphia Eagles man Jalen Hurts. He’s the quarterback who supplies the passes for Saquon Barkley to latch onto, and he’s enjoy a productive campaign at the heart of the Eagles’ offense.

As underdogs for a Super Bowl win, the Washington Commanders aren’t expected to go deep into the playoffs, but fans should pay close attention to Jayden Daniels. He’s another quarterback, but Daniels stands out on this list because this is his rookie season. It’s been an impressive start to his professional career, and there will be more to come from this promising player.

Other names to watch as the postseason develops include Sam Darnold of the Minnesota Vikings and Justin Herbert of the LA Chargers.
